The Ascherhütte is at 2256 m height in the Samnaungruppe surrounded by Blankakopf and Rotpleiskopf. It is in the possession of the section Oberpfaffenhofen - Asch of the DAV and is open from early July to mid-September.
history
The Ascher hut was built in 1896 by the Asch section of the former German-Austrian Alpine Club. It was a small one-room hut with storage rooms separated by a curtain. Back then, the hut was not only open in summer, it was also open to tourers in spring from Easter.
On the occasion of the expulsion of the Sudeten Germans from their homeland after the Second World War , the members of the Asch section were distributed all over Germany. As early as 1952, 14 members revived the section in Selb . The Section quickly won back many of the old members. In order to be able to take better care of the Ascher Hütte, the section headquarters were relocated to Munich .
Renovation plans for the hut were started in 1957. The ridge alignment was changed, but part of the old hut was integrated into the new building. With an expansion in 1975, the hut got its current size. The centenary of the hut was celebrated on July 6, 1996.
Accesses
- from lake ( 1050 m ) through the Schallertal, walking time: 4 hours
- from the Medrig-Alm, material cable car, walking time: 2 hours
- from Pifang via the Medrig-Alm, walking time: 4–5 hours
- from Tobadill ( 1136 m ), walking time: 6 hours
